Protein Name: Alpha-internexin

UniprotKB/SwissProt ID: AINX_MOUSE (P46660)

Gene Name: Ina

Organism: Mus musculus (Mouse).

Function: Class-IV neuronal intermediate filament that is able to self-assemble. It is involved in the morphogenesis of neurons. It may form an independent structural network without the involvement of other neurofilaments or it may cooperate with NF-L to form the filamentous backbone to which NF-M and NF-H attach to form the cross-bridges (By similarity).
